Capcon is a leading supplier of stocktaking services to the licenced and hospitality industry including large Pub chains, major Hotel Companies and Holiday Parks.

Ideally, you will be currently working at supervisory or management level within the pub or hotel industry and can demonstrate a sound understanding of the food & beverage stocktaking and audit process.

Excellent communication skills, working knowledge of Word and Excel and to be of smart appearance are all prerequisites of the role.

As a key member of their stocktaking team, it will be your duty to accurately count food & beverage, conduct spirit ABV tests, generate written and numerical reports, hold formal de-brief meetings with clients and provide related business advice.

Our client base offers plenty of variety working at a different venue each day and our stocktaking and audit processes are completed on a number of platforms including our own and client’s software.

Your own vehicle and a full driving licence are essential as is the flexibility to stay away from home on an occasional basis. Early starts based on client requirements may also be required.

We offer a competitive package which includes a Pension Scheme and Health Cover.

Salary - £95 per full day plus £22 car allowance for each day worked. Overtime also available. After 6 months probation the day rate increases to £104.50
